  • How do i get rid of the other data on my iphone 4s

    I have tried restoring my iphone, but the "other" data returns and continues to take up over 1.5G of my space. I would really like to get rid of the "other" data for good.

    "Other" is YOUR DATA. If you get rid of it you will lose your email messages and settings, all of your texts and iMessages, all of your system settings, etc.
    "Other" data is real data that you put on your phone by using the built in apps. It is not music, not videos, not pictures and not App Store app data. It is "OTHER" meaning everything that does not fall into these categories. Such as:
    email messages and attachments
    Reminders
    Notes
    Calendar entries
    Contacts
    Text messages
    MMS messages and attachments
    Genius data
    Music cover art
    Operating system settings
    Safari cache
    bookmarks
    Game Center status
    Music catalog

  • Since downloading ios5 on my iphone 4 the capacity guage in itunes shows other as over 21Gb and i can no longer fit any music on it. How do I get rid of the other stuff? other

    Since downloading ios5 on my iphone 4 a few days ago, the capacity guage in itunes shows "other" as over 21Gb and i can no longer fit any music on my iphone.
    How do I get rid of the other stuff?
    capacity available on 32 Gb iphone is 28.49Gb
    i previously had 21.97 Gb music, over 6 Gb photos, about 1Gb of apps, and minute amount of audio
    now i have no music, 5.4 Gb photos and similar (0.8Gb) for  apps and audio. i have deleted heaps of photos and unused apps to try to make space but obviosly this is a much bigger problem. I also created a smaller music folder on itunes to sync to but at present no music is selected for syncing due to the lack of available space.
    i have 15Gb icloud account now also which is about half full.
    Ive done a little research and heard similar tales but with much smaller other totals than this. Can you help?
    i cant update my apps as i get a message saying i do not have enough available space.

    I had the same problem today and was able to resolve it without having to do a restore or reset. The problem had something to do with my mail accounts. The upgrade reset my mail settings, switching both my gmail and my .mac mail to "archive all mail". I went into the General Settings, disabled that setting, and resynced the phone. The "other" storage allottment dropped back down to less than a gig.
    Before you restore or reset, I would try that first.

  • When I go in I cloud data storage, it says I have 3.3gb from an old phone which was replaced by a new phone. The new phone has 1.2gb of data. Can I now get rid of the data on the old phone from the i cloud.

    When I go in I cloud data storage, it says I have 3.3gb from an old phone which was replaced by a new phone. The new phone has 1.2gb of data. So I now have a total of 4.5GB OF DATA stored. The Old phone is now with Apple and I deleted all the information.  Can I now get rid of the data on I cloud for the old phone. What data does the 3.3GB consist of? Is there anyway, I can find out?
    Thanks

    When you delete an iCloud backup it is permanently deleted and not available in the future to restore from.  The backup of your second phone only contains the data and settings from that phone.  If any of this data was inherited from your first phone, it would be contained in the backup of your second phone as it was on your second phone when it was backed up.
    If you want to keep backups of your old phone, back them up in iTunes and they will remain on your computer.  Even if you are backing up to iCloud, you can manually back up your phone in iTunes by right-clicking on the name of your phone on the left side of iTunes and selecting Back Up.  iTunes will see each device as a separate device, and will maintain the backups separately.  Do this with your first phone and you can then delete the iCloud backup and you will have the iTunes backup on your computer should you ever want to access it.
